Abseil 100m into the surreal Lost World. Descend slowly, suspended in the massive void. Mist-filtered light gives unreal qualities to the strange plants and formations. Then embark on an underworld trek and climb back through the majestic dry passages of the Mangapu cave system.
The abseil (rappel) descent takes around 20 minutes of the total 4 hours required.
Abseil slowly alongside your instructor who although on a separate rope provides information, reassurance …and a backup safety tether.
Imagine free-hanging in this massive void…bouncing a bit & turning because of the sheer length of the rope. Look around into upper levels of the cave and giant spagatites (look like giant green hands growing out of the walls). Weird plants struggle to cling to the sheer walls and all the while the roar of the Mangapu river echoes up from caverns far below.
It feels like you’re descending into the bowels of some gigantic prehistoric beast…a sensory feast.
